Maurice Richard has signed three of the five frames offered here, including a huge Michel Lapensee tribute to the Rocket, one of three limited edition prints in this lot by the renowned Montreal sports artist. The Habs legend has signed in black marker at the bottom of his 30" x 25" career tribute titled "Rocket" displayed in a 37" x 32" wood frame, signed in pencil by Lapensee. It is numbered 200 of 9,999, the same as two 9" x 10" Lapensee lithos, titled "Passion" and "1 vs 9" and mounted in 16 1/4" x 17 1/4" wood frames. All three Lapensee lithos come with individual COAs, while two signed Richard laminates have COAs attached to the reverse. The Rocket has signed in silver sharpie on a 13 1/4" x 10 5/8" laminate of his iconic handshake photo with Boston's Sugar Jim Henry from the 1952 playoffs. His black sharpie autograph appears on a raised 5 3/4" x 10 3/8" laminated photo of him attacking the Maple Leafs' net mounted on a 9" x 13 1/2" black and gold wood plaque.
